Syncfusion® Essential Studio est une suite de composants et de frameworks pour le développement d'applications web, mobiles et de bureau.
Le cadre d'interface utilisateur le plus complet pour accélérer votre développement HTML/JS
Divi est un thème WordPress et un constructeur de pages visuel qui permet aux utilisateurs de créer des sites web époustouflants et réactifs sans aucune connaissance en codage. Son interface intuitive de glisser-déposer permet une conception en temps réel, rendant la création de sites web accessible aussi bien aux débutants qu'aux professionnels. Caractéristiques clés et fonctionnalités : - Constructeur visuel de glisser-déposer : Concevez des pages en temps réel avec une interface conviviale qui ne nécessite aucun codage. - Plus de 200 éléments de design : Accédez à une vaste bibliothèque de modules, y compris des curseurs, des galeries, des formulaires, et plus encore, pour améliorer la fonctionnalité du site web. - Plus de 2 000 mises en page préconçues : Utilisez une large gamme de modèles conçus professionnellement pour démarrer des projets de sites web. - Édition réactive : Assurez-vous que les sites web sont superbes sur tous les appareils grâce aux contrôles de conception réactive. - Constructeur de thème : Personnalisez les en-têtes, pieds de page et autres zones globales pour un design de site cohérent. - Intégration du commerce électronique : Créez facilement des boutiques en ligne avec la compatibilité WooCommerce et des modules dédiés. - Options de design avancées : Affinez chaque aspect d'un site web avec des paramètres de design étendus, y compris la typographie, l'espacement et les animations. Valeur principale et solutions : Divi simplifie le processus de conception web en fournissant une solution tout-en-un qui combine un thème puissant avec un constructeur de pages flexible. Il élimine le besoin de multiples plugins ou de codage personnalisé, permettant aux utilisateurs de concevoir et de gérer leurs sites web efficacement. Que ce soit pour créer un blog personnel, un site d'entreprise ou une boutique en ligne, Divi offre les outils et la flexibilité pour donner vie à n'importe quelle vision.
Django est un framework web open-source de haut niveau écrit en Python qui permet le développement rapide de sites web sécurisés et maintenables. Il suit le modèle architectural Model-Template-View (MTV), promouvant une séparation claire entre les modèles de données, les interfaces utilisateur et la logique applicative. Initialement développé pour répondre aux exigences rapides des environnements de salles de rédaction, Django a évolué en un framework polyvalent utilisé par des organisations du monde entier. Caractéristiques clés et fonctionnalités : - Développement rapide : La conception de Django facilite une progression rapide du concept à la réalisation, permettant aux développeurs de créer des applications efficacement. - Outils complets : Le framework inclut des fonctionnalités intégrées pour l'authentification des utilisateurs, l'administration de contenu, les plans de site, les flux RSS, et plus encore, réduisant le besoin de bibliothèques externes. - Sécurité : Django met l'accent sur la sécurité en fournissant des protections contre les vulnérabilités courantes telles que l'injection SQL, le cross-site scripting et la falsification de requêtes intersites. - Scalabilité : Conçu pour gérer des demandes à fort trafic, Django alimente certains des sites les plus fréquentés sur Internet, démontrant sa capacité à évoluer efficacement. - Polyvalence : Convient à une large gamme d'applications, des systèmes de gestion de contenu aux réseaux sociaux et aux plateformes de calcul scientifique. Valeur principale et solutions pour les utilisateurs : Django simplifie le processus de développement web en offrant un framework robuste qui gère de nombreuses tâches courantes dès le départ. Cela permet aux développeurs de se concentrer sur l'écriture de fonctionnalités d'application uniques sans réinventer la roue. Son accent sur la sécurité et la scalabilité garantit que les applications construites avec Django sont à la fois fiables et capables de croître avec les besoins des utilisateurs. En adhérant au principe "Don't Repeat Yourself" (DRY), Django promeut la réutilisabilité et la maintenabilité du code, ce qui en fait un choix idéal pour les développeurs visant à créer des applications web efficaces et sécurisées.
Angular est une plateforme complète pour construire des applications web dynamiques à page unique en utilisant HTML et TypeScript. Elle fournit un cadre robuste qui permet aux développeurs de créer des applications efficaces et évolutives sur diverses plateformes, y compris le web, le web mobile, le mobile natif et le bureau natif. Caractéristiques clés et fonctionnalités : - Développement multiplateforme : Angular permet aux développeurs de créer des applications qui peuvent fonctionner de manière transparente sur plusieurs plateformes, facilitant la réutilisation du code et réduisant le temps de développement. - Haute performance : Le cadre est optimisé pour une vitesse maximale sur la plateforme web, incorporant des fonctionnalités comme les Web Workers et le rendu côté serveur pour améliorer les performances. - Architecture modulaire : Le design modulaire d'Angular, grâce à l'utilisation des NgModules, aide à organiser les applications en blocs de fonctionnalités cohérents, les rendant plus faciles à gérer et à faire évoluer. - Outils complets : Avec une large gamme d'outils et de bibliothèques, Angular simplifie le processus de développement. Il offre des modèles déclaratifs, un support IDE étendu et un riche écosystème de composants et de directives. - Fort soutien communautaire : Soutenu par une grande communauté et maintenu par Google, Angular bénéficie d'améliorations continues, d'une documentation étendue et d'une multitude de ressources tierces. Valeur principale et solutions fournies : Angular répond aux défis du développement d'applications web complexes en offrant une approche structurée et maintenable. Son architecture basée sur les composants favorise la réutilisabilité et la testabilité, tandis que ses systèmes puissants de liaison de données et d'injection de dépendances simplifient le développement. En fournissant une plateforme unifiée avec des modèles et des pratiques cohérents, Angular permet aux développeurs de construire des applications de haute qualité de manière efficace, réduisant à la fois le temps de développement et les coûts de maintenance.
Laravel Breeze est un kit de démarrage léger conçu pour simplifier la mise en œuvre des fonctionnalités d'authentification dans les applications Laravel. Il offre une approche minimaliste, fournissant des fonctionnalités essentielles telles que la connexion utilisateur, l'inscription, la réinitialisation du mot de passe, la vérification de l'email et la confirmation du mot de passe. En utilisant le moteur de templates natif Blade de Laravel et le style avec Tailwind CSS, Breeze assure une interface utilisateur moderne et réactive. Ce package est idéal pour les développeurs cherchant une base simple et personnalisable pour leurs projets. Caractéristiques principales : - Système d'authentification simple : Inclut des fonctionnalités d'authentification fondamentales comme la connexion, l'inscription, la réinitialisation du mot de passe, la vérification de l'email et la confirmation du mot de passe. - Style Tailwind CSS : Utilise Tailwind CSS pour le style, offrant un design contemporain et réactif prêt à l'emploi. - Templating Blade : Exploite le moteur de templates natif Blade de Laravel pour une expérience de développement fluide. - Personnalisable : Publie les contrôleurs et vues d'authentification directement dans votre application, facilitant la modification et l'extension selon les besoins. Valeur principale : Laravel Breeze simplifie le processus de configuration de l'authentification dans les applications Laravel, permettant aux développeurs de se concentrer sur la création de fonctionnalités uniques sans le fardeau de configurer l'authentification à partir de zéro. Son design minimaliste et sa dépendance à Blade et Tailwind CSS fournissent un point de départ propre et efficace, le rendant particulièrement bénéfique pour les projets nécessitant un système d'authentification simple sans complexité supplémentaire.
Créer et partager des idées visuelles
Rapide, non-opinioné, cadre web minimaliste pour Node.js
Chart.js est une bibliothèque JavaScript gratuite et open-source conçue pour la visualisation de données, permettant aux développeurs de créer des graphiques interactifs et réactifs pour les applications web. Elle prend en charge huit types de graphiques principaux : barres, lignes, aires, secteurs (anneaux), bulles, radar, aires polaires et nuages de points. Initialement développée par Nick Downie en 2013, Chart.js a évolué en un projet maintenu par la communauté, reconnu pour sa simplicité et sa flexibilité dans le rendu des graphiques en utilisant le canvas HTML5. Caractéristiques clés et fonctionnalités : - Multiples types de graphiques : Offre une variété de types de graphiques, y compris les graphiques à barres, lignes, aires, secteurs (anneaux), bulles, radar, aires polaires et nuages de points. - Personnalisation : Hautement personnalisable avec des options pour les animations, infobulles, légendes, et plus encore. - Design réactif : S'ajuste automatiquement aux différentes tailles d'écran et appareils, assurant un affichage optimal sur toutes les plateformes. - Intégration : Compatible avec des frameworks JavaScript populaires comme React, Vue, Svelte et Angular, et inclut des typages TypeScript pour une expérience de développement améliorée. - Performance : Utilise le canvas HTML5 pour le rendu, offrant une performance efficace, surtout avec de grands ensembles de données. - Extensibilité : Prend en charge les plugins pour des fonctionnalités supplémentaires telles que les annotations, le zoom et les fonctionnalités de glisser-déposer. Valeur principale et solutions pour les utilisateurs : Chart.js simplifie le processus d'intégration de graphiques dynamiques et interactifs dans les applications web, rendant accessible aux développeurs la présentation visuelle des données sans codage intensif. Sa facilité d'utilisation, combinée à un ensemble riche de fonctionnalités et d'options de personnalisation, permet la création de graphiques de qualité professionnelle qui améliorent l'engagement des utilisateurs et la compréhension des données. En offrant une solution légère et réactive, Chart.js répond au besoin d'outils de visualisation de données efficaces et adaptables dans le développement web moderne.